Min Qualification: Degree Experience: Level: Mid level Experience: Length: 3 years Language Requirement: English Working Hours: Full Time - 8 to 5 Applicant Location: Lagos, Nigeria Job descriptions & requirements: Responsibilities: Manage the full employee lifecycle, from recruitment and onboarding to performance management and exit processes. Develop and implement HR policies, procedures, and employee guidelines. Coordinate recruitment, interviews, reference checks, offers, and onboarding of new employees. Maintain accurate and confidential employee records. Monitor staff attendance, leave, punctuality, and general compliance with company policies. Develop and manage staff performance appraisal and KPI processes. Support managers in addressing employee performance and disciplinary matters. Coordinate staff training, development, and professional growth initiatives. Manage employee relations and promote a positive workplace culture. Handle employee grievances and workplace concerns professionally and confidentially. Ensure employment contracts, HR documentation, and personnel records are properly maintained. Support payroll preparation by providing accurate attendance, leave, salary, and staff-related information. Monitor compliance with applicable employment laws and statutory requirements. Administration Management Oversee the day-to-day administrative operations of the studio. Develop and maintain efficient administrative systems and processes. Manage office supplies, equipment, facilities, and general office requirements. Coordinate relationships with office vendors, service providers, and external consultants. Monitor office expenses and support effective administrative cost control. Maintain proper filing, documentation, and records management systems. Coordinate meetings, internal events, staff activities, and other administrative requirements. Ensure the studio maintains a professional, organized, safe, and productive working environment. Manage office access, security, maintenance, and general facility requirements. Develop and maintain administrative policies and procedures. Identify recurring performance or behavioural issues and recommend appropriate interventions. Promote accountability, professionalism, teamwork, and effective communication across the studio. Ensure HR and administrative practices comply with company policies and applicable Nigerian employment regulations. Maintain confidentiality of employee and company information. Ensure required HR and administrative documentation is complete and up to date. Requirements: BSc. in Human Resources Management, or a related field. 3+ years of relevant HR and administrative experience, preferably with management or supervisory experience. Professional HR certification such as CIPM, SHRM, HRCI, or equivalent is an advantage. Strong understanding of HR practices and Nigerian employment regulations. Experience: managing recruitment, performance management, employee relations, and HR administration. Strong administrative and organizational skills. Excellent written and verbal communication skills. Strong interpersonal and conflict-resolution skills. Proficiency in Microsoft Office, Slack, and Google Workspace. Experience: with HR/payroll or employee management software is an advantage.
